随着工业互联网的快速发展,如何实现工业设备、生产过程、供应链等各个方面的实时监控和高效管理成为亟待解决的问题。OpenTelemetry作为一种开源的分布式追踪系统,能够有效地解决这一问题。本文将探讨OpenTelemetry在工业互联网中的监控创新实践,以期为我国工业互联网的发展提供参考。
一、OpenTelemetry简介
OpenTelemetry是一个由Google、微软、红帽等公司共同发起的开源项目,旨在提供一套统一的分布式追踪、监控和日志系统。它通过统一的API、协议和工具,实现了跨语言、跨平台的监控和追踪。OpenTelemetry的主要特点如下:
跨语言:支持多种编程语言,如Java、Python、C++等,方便开发者根据实际需求选择合适的语言进行开发。
跨平台:适用于各种操作系统,如Linux、Windows、macOS等,以及各种云平台和容器平台。
统一API:提供统一的API接口,方便开发者进行监控和追踪。
开放协议:采用开源协议,支持多种数据格式和传输方式,如Prometheus、Jaeger等。
二、OpenTelemetry在工业互联网中的监控创新实践
- 设备级监控
在工业互联网中,设备级监控是至关重要的。OpenTelemetry能够实现设备级的监控,通过在设备上部署代理程序,实时收集设备运行状态、性能指标、故障信息等数据。这些数据可以用于以下方面:
(1)设备健康状态监控:通过分析设备运行数据,及时发现设备故障和异常,提高设备运行效率。
(2)性能优化:根据设备性能指标,对设备进行优化,提高生产效率。
(3)故障预测:通过分析设备历史数据,预测设备故障,提前进行维护,降低故障率。
- 生产过程监控
OpenTelemetry可以实现对生产过程的实时监控,包括生产线、工艺流程、物料运输等。通过采集生产过程中的数据,可以实现以下功能:
(1)生产进度监控:实时掌握生产进度,确保生产计划顺利进行。
(2)质量监控:分析生产过程中的数据,及时发现质量问题,提高产品质量。
(3)能源消耗监控:监测能源消耗情况,实现节能减排。
- 供应链监控
供应链是工业互联网的重要组成部分,OpenTelemetry可以实现对供应链的实时监控,包括原材料采购、生产、物流、销售等环节。以下为供应链监控的几个方面:
(1)采购监控:实时监控原材料采购情况,确保供应链稳定。
(2)生产监控:监控生产过程中的物料消耗、生产效率等,提高生产效率。
(3)物流监控:实时跟踪物流信息,提高物流效率,降低物流成本。
- 数据分析与应用
OpenTelemetry收集到的海量数据可以用于数据分析与应用,为工业互联网提供决策支持。以下为数据分析与应用的几个方面:
(1)趋势分析:分析历史数据,预测未来发展趋势,为生产计划提供依据。
(2)异常检测:根据历史数据,识别异常情况,提前预警。
(3)预测性维护:通过分析设备运行数据,预测设备故障,提前进行维护。
三、总结
OpenTelemetry在工业互联网中的监控创新实践,为我国工业互联网的发展提供了有力支持。通过实现设备级、生产过程、供应链等各个方面的实时监控,提高生产效率、降低成本、保障供应链稳定。未来,随着OpenTelemetry的不断发展和完善,其在工业互联网中的应用将更加广泛,为我国工业互联网的快速发展提供有力保障。